    Job Description The sawmill machine operator trainee will learn the skills to control automated equipment in the sawmill to process timber into lumber, which involves monitoring machinery, ensuring optimal cuts, maintaining equipment, and performing quality control. Key duties include operating saws to cut logs, planing rough lumber to specific dimensions, clearing jams, performing maintenance, and following strict safety protocols to maximize lumber recovery and minimize waste. Key Responsibilities Machine Operation: Operate automated equipment, such as head rig, saws and planing machines , to cut, trim, and shape logs and rough lumber into finished lumber products of various sizes. Process Monitoring: Monitor equipment performance, lumber flow, and computer screens to ensure machinery is operating efficiently and that cuts meet specifications. Quality Control: Ensure the correct flow of wood, correct orientation of optimization systems, and optimal cutting to maximize recovery and minimize waste. Maintenance: Clean and oil machinery, clear jams from equipment and conveyors, and perform other routine tasks to keep the equipment in working order. Safety: Adhere to strict safety protocols and maintain a safe work environment by following established procedures. Required Skills Mechanical Aptitude: Ability to understand and operate complex machinery. Attention to Detail: To monitor cuts and ensure quality and precision in processing. Problem-Solving Skills: To identify and resolve issues such as equipment jams or inefficiencies. Physical Stamina: The job can involve a lot of standing and physical work. Safety Consciousness: A strong commitment to safety procedures. Preferred Skill Head Rig operation experience

How much does a forklift operator earn in Bellview, FL?

The average forklift operator in Bellview, FL earns between $26,000 and $39,000 annually. This compares to the national average forklift operator range of $27,000 to $42,000.

Average forklift operator salary in Bellview, FL

$32,000
